In China, energy consumption is mainly derived from fossil energy category, out of which CO2 in the combustion process is responsible for the environment deterioration and climate change. Recently, greenhouse gases emitted during China’s fossil fuel burning ranks the first in the long-term and presents the increasing emissions share year by year. Thus, CO2 emissions reduction is the common responsibility and international obligation of all the nations in the world. Especially, it is crucial to study on the trend variation and future development situation of CO2 emissions. Being the large province of industry, Hebei shows ever-increasing industrial CO2 emissions with the rapid development of economy. It is of both theoretical and modern significance to achieve low-carbon development pattern of industry, realize energy conservation and promote sustainable economic development in Hebei. In this regard, through the analysis of industrial energy consumption and CO2 emissions status, this paper employs STIRPAT model and partial least-squares(PLS) regression to carry out factor decomposition and future scenarios of industrial carbon emissions in Hebei.The article mainly included the following works: Firstly, system analysis of industrial carbon emissions in Hebei is presented, including industrial economic development situation, industrial energy situation, industrial CO2 emissions situation. Among them, analysis of industrial energy structure and future trends prediction are adopted. Secondly, this paper performs empirical study by STIRPAT model and partial least-squares(PLS) regression. Besides, all impact factors are rank ed according to their importance and conducted detailed impact degree evaluation. Finally, this paper concludes with scenario analysis and policy proposal of future CO2 emissions in Hebei. For one thing, scenario analysis of overall industrial CO2 emissions are implemented by setting three scenarios and analyzing CO2 emissions and carbon intensity under different strength of carbon reduction respectively. For another, we provide policy suggestions on industry emission reduction in Hebei based on emission-cutting focus in Hebei.
